原文:对象里面的属性有值但是打印出来是空的,获取不到

如下,对象 obj 的 arr 属性是个数组,是有内容的,但是获取 obj.arr 的时候 获取的是空数组 纠结了半天,突然意识到会不会是异步造成的, 果然,obj.arr 属性我是用ajax 请求完之后 赋值过去的,部分代码如下: 我赋值的代码 是在请求之外,导致了异步。 把这个赋值的代码放到请求里面就好了,修改后的代码如下: 就是异步导致的问题。 ...

2018-09-14 16:08 0 1666 推荐指数:

查看详情

打印出js对象里面的内容

最近调试的时候遇到需要打印出js对象里面的内容,两种方式: 1.直接使用 方法把对象转成字符串,打印出来。但是因为维护的项目比较老,使用的还是ie11的ie5兼容模式,报了JSON对象未定义的错误。因此有了下面的这种方式。 2.自己写了个js方法,来打印对象 ...

Tue Aug 27 18:16:00 CST 2019 1 7154
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M